'New Way of Stealing Cars': Hacking Them With A Laptop (marketwatch.com)
retroworks writes: The Wall Street Journal (Warning: source may be paywalled), CBS and Marketwatch all lead the morning with stories about the newest method of stealing (late model) cars. No need for hacking off the ignition switch and touching the wires to create a spark (controversial during broadcasts in 1970s television crime criticized for "teaching people to steal cars"). Thieves now use the laptop to access the automobile's computer system, and voila. "Police and car insurers say thieves are using laptop computers to hack into late-model cars' electronic ignitions to steal the vehicles, raising alarms about the auto industry's greater use of computer controls. The discovery follows a recent incident in Houston in which a pair of car thieves were caught on camera using a laptop to start a 2010 Jeep Wrangler and steal it from the owner's driveway. Police say the same method may have been used in the theft of four other late-model Wranglers and Cherokees in the city. None of the vehicles have been recovered." The article concludes with the example filmed of a break-in in Houston. The thief, says the NICB's Mr. Morris, likely used the laptop to manipulate the car's computer to recognize a signal sent from an electronic key the thief then used to turn on the ignition. The computer reads the signal and allows the key to turn. "We have no idea how many cars have been broken into using this method," Mr. Morris said. "We think it is minuscule in the overall car thefts but it does show these hackers will do anything to stay one step ahead." I've got an A8 which is a rolling PITA, but it's interesting what is and what isn't easy to work on. The blower motor is trivial to replace as it's done from beneath the hood. I believe the heater cores require dash removal... it's either that or engine removal, I'd have to look it up. You can officially get at almost all of the climate control servos without dash removal, and unofficially get at all of them. But the heater core control valve is in a horrible location and you're supposed to remove the brake servo. If you are crafty, you don't have to do that, but the alternative is not fun either. All of the major hidden modules are trivial to access; the ABS is behind the driver's kick panel, and the PCM, TCM, and CCM are in an "e-Box" under the hood. The stereo comes out easily with fairly typical removal tools, but in order to get out the climate control module which lives right next to it out, you need to take out the floor mats and center console trim panels from both sides, remove the center vent, remove the stereo, and pull the whole center stack out of the dash including all of the big switches.
Anyway, everything continues in this vein... the intake manifold is trivial to remove but the oil cooler is a nightmare. I think the truth is that you're just running into basic limitations of what people expect and what it is reasonable to produce and assemble in the factory. There's only so much space in the car to make convenient maintenance access. On the other hand, some of it really is just bad design.
